Building fo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include identifying signs of foundation problems, such as cracks, uneven flooring, or sticking doors and windows, and implementing sol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ation.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or the installation of support beams to restore the foundation’s integrity. Proper foundation repair helps prevent further structural damage and ensures the safety and stability of the building.

The primary problems addressed by foundation repair services are often caused by soil movement, moisture changes, or settling over time. These issues can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, and compromised structural support. Left unaddressed, foundation problems can worsen, resulting in costly repairs and potential safety hazards. Professional contractors use specialized techniques and equipment to diagnose the root causes of foundation issues and provide effective solutions tailored to the specific needs of each property.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. For minor cracks, costs may be closer to $2,000,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.

Material and Method Expenses - Costs vary based on the repair materials and techniques, such as piering or mudjacking. On average, materials may add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total project, with more complex methods increasing overall costs.

Size and Severity Factors - Larger or more severe foundation issues typically lead to higher costs, often between $4,000 and $12,000. Smaller cracks or minor settling repairs generally fall within the lower end of the price range.

Additional Service Fees - Extra charges may include excavation, soil stabilization, or waterproofing, which can add $1,500 to $5,000 or more. Local service providers can assess the specific scope to determine total expenses.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or do not close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but many projects can be completed within a few days to a week.

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? It is advisable to have a professional evaluate minor cracks to determine if they are superficial or require more extensive repair to prevent future issues.

What causes foundation problems in homes? Common causes include soil movement,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, or inadequate initial construction, which can lead to settling or shifting of the foundation.
